What Is a Media Manager?

A media manager oversees the various aspects of a company’s presence in print and on the web, TV, and radio. In larger companies, you lead teams of marketers who focus on particular media types, but in small businesses, your job may encompass all media presence. Your job duties include developing marketing opportunities, creating content, and updating the company’s website and social media posts. You may engage directly with clients and the public via social media platforms. Excellent organization and communication skills are a must.

What is the difference between Media Manager vs Content Coordinator?

AspectMedia ManagerContent Coordinator
CredentialsBachelor's in Marketing, Communications, or related field; experience in media planningBachelor's in Communications, Journalism, or related; strong writing and editing skills
Work EnvironmentMedia agencies, marketing departments, digital platformsContent teams, marketing departments, media companies
ResponsibilitiesOversees media campaigns, manages media budgets, analyzes media performanceCoordinates content creation, schedules publishing, ensures content quality

The Media Manager focuses on planning, executing, and analyzing media campaigns across various platforms, managing budgets and media strategies. In contrast, the Content Coordinator handles content creation, scheduling, and quality control to ensure consistent messaging. Both roles often collaborate but serve different functions within marketing and media teams.
